1. Start with a Plan
Before diving into the organization process, it’s essential to have a plan in place. Follow these steps to create an effective organization plan:
A. Identify Problem Areas
Walk through your home and identify the areas that require the most attention. These could be cluttered countertops, overflowing closets, or messy storage spaces.
B. Prioritize Areas
Once you’ve identified the problem areas, prioritize them based on urgency and importance. Start with the spaces that cause the most frustration or are used frequently.
C. Set Realistic Goals
Break down your organization plan into small, manageable goals. This will help you stay motivated and prevent overwhelm. For example, focus on decluttering one room or one specific area at a time.
2. Declutter and Donate
Decluttering is a crucial step in home organization. Follow these steps to efficiently declutter your living spaces:
A. Sort and Categorize
Start by sorting your belongings into categories. For example, create piles for items to keep, donate, sell, or discard. This process will help you assess the quantity of items you own and make decisions more effectively.
B. Evaluate Each Item
As you go through your belongings, ask yourself if each item is useful or brings you joy. If not, consider donating or selling it. Be ruthless in your decision-making to avoid holding onto unnecessary items.
C. Organize a Donation/Selling System
Set up boxes or bags specifically for donations and items to sell. Once you’ve finished decluttering, promptly donate or sell these items to avoid them piling up and becoming clutter again.
3. Use Storage Solutions
Proper storage solutions are essential for maintaining an organized home. Consider the following storage ideas for different areas of your house:
A. Closets and Wardrobes
Install additional shelves, drawers, or hanging rods to maximize closet space. Utilize storage bins or baskets to categorize and store smaller items.
B. Kitchen
Use drawer dividers to keep utensils and cutlery organized. Install spice racks or drawer inserts for better accessibility. Use clear storage containers for pantry items to keep them fresh and visible.
C. Bathroom
Install shower caddies or hanging organizers to keep toiletries neat and accessible. Use drawer dividers to separate and organize makeup and other beauty products. Install towel racks or hooks to keep towels off the floor.
D. Living Areas
Invest in storage ottomans or coffee tables with hidden compartments for storing blankets, magazines, and remote controls. Use decorative bins or baskets to keep toys, books, or media accessories organized.
4. Label and Categorize
Labeling and categorizing items can significantly enhance organization and make it easier to find things when needed. Follow these steps to implement effective labeling:
A. Label Storage Containers
Use adhesive labels or a label maker to clearly mark storage containers. Include details such as the contents, location, and date if applicable. This makes it easier to find specific items and maintain an organized system.
B. Create a Home for Everything
Designate a specific place for each item in your home. Whether it’s a designated shelf, drawer, or container, ensure that every item has a designated spot to avoid clutter and confusion.
5. Establish Daily Routines
Maintaining an organized home requires consistent effort. Establishing daily routines can help you stay on top of organization tasks. Consider the following routines:
A. Cleaning Up Before Bed
Spend a few minutes each night tidying up common areas and putting items back in their designated places. This habit ensures a clutter-free start to the next day.
B. Implementing a “One In, One Out” Rule
For every new item you bring into your home, commit to removing one item. This prevents accumulation and encourages regular decluttering.
C. Weekly Maintenance Tasks
Set aside specific days or times each week for maintenance tasks such as dusting, vacuuming, and wiping down surfaces. This regular maintenance keeps your home looking tidy and organized.
